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- RPL group: history of at least two spontaneous pregnancy losses, regardless of whether they have living children, and whose etiology for the pregnancy losses was not determined by the care team\'s protocols;
- Control group: at least two full-term pregnancies and no history of difficulty getting pregnant, pregnancy loss or other infertility factors.
Exclusion
- RPL group: less than two spontaneous pregnancy losses and those with a known cause for repeated pregnancy losses;
- Control group: N/A
